From a349f1cee68f4f59c0b2abb32348cfaad98239bd Mon Sep 17 00:00:00 2001 From: Banks T Date: Tue, 28 Jul 2020 20:22:08 -0400 Subject: [PATCH] CI Java test fix (#61) * Fix triple test run, task names * Typo fix --- .github/workflows/main.yml | 22 ++++++++++++---------- 1 file changed, 12 insertions(+), 10 deletions(-) di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index caa64098c..efe15fd9d 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-58,26 +58,28 @@ jobs: steps: # Checkout code. - - uses: actions/checkout@v1 + - name: Checkout code + uses: actions/checkout@v1 # Install Java 11. - - uses: actions/setup-java@v1 + - name: Install Java 11 + uses: actions/setup-java@v1 with: java-version: 11 # Run Gradle build. - - run: | + - name: Gradle Build + run: | chmod +x gradlew - ./gradlew build + ./gradlew build -x check - # Run Gradle tests. - - run: ./gradlew test - - # Generate Coverage Report. - - run: ./gradlew jacocoTestReport + # Run Tests Generate Coverage Report. + - name: Gradle Test and Coverage + run: ./gradlew jacocoTestReport # Publish Coverage Report. - - uses: codecov/codecov-action@v1 + - name: Publish Coverage Report + uses: codecov/codecov-action@v1 with: file: ./photon-server/build/reports/jacoco/test/jacocoTestReport.xml